Microbus seen to follow Mitu’s murderers seized

Police claimed to have seized the black microbus which was seen in CCTV footages to follow the three motorbike-riding assailants after murder of Superintendent of Police (SP)’s wife Mahmuda Khanam Mitu and believed to be a backup force for the killers from Chittagong city.

Confirming the seizure of the microbus, Chittagong Metropolitan Police (CMP) Commissioner Iqbal Bahar told the Dhaka Tribune over phone that the microbus was recovered from the Chittagong city Wednesday evening.”

“Police were verifying all the information of the microbus”, he added.

However, the CMP boss did not want to disclose the detailed information regarding the seizure saying that the details will be revealed on Thursday at CMP headquarters.

Earlier in the morning, CMP’s Additional Commissioner (Crime and Operation) Devdas Bhattacharia told the journalists: “Police are working to collect all information about the black microbus… and we are trying to trace out it where the microbus moved after accomplishing the killing mission.”

On Tuesday, CMP commissioner, after scrutinizing the CCTV footages, said the law enforcing agencies have pretty sure that the microbus was kept at the crime scene as a backup force for the killers.

“Usually militants use to keep a backup force during their operations. It did not use at the operation as it was not necessary during that. If it was necessary the attackers might have used it,” said Iqbal Bahar.

Mahmuda Khanam Mitu, wife of SP Babul Akter, was stabbed and shot to death by three unidentified motorbike-riding assailants in front of her son Akter Mahmud Maheer near their house in Chittagong city’s GEC area on last Sunday when she was going to drop her son at school bus.
